Patient Registration Forms: What You Need to Know
Streamlining the patient intake process is crucial for any healthcare facility. Well-designed patient intake forms are essential for gathering key details about new and existing patients, ensuring accurate record-keeping, and facilitating efficient care delivery. These forms typically encompass sections such as personal information, contact details, medical history, insurance details, and consent for procedures.
- Utilizing clear and concise phrases is essential for ensuring that patients can easily understand and complete the forms.
- Take into account providing step-by-step instructions or assistance to navigate the process smoothly.
- Offering multiple formats for the forms, such as online, paper, or smartphone-ready, can boost patient convenience and accessibility.
Moreover, it's important to establish robust privacy measures protocols to safeguard sensitive patient information. By adhering to these best practices, healthcare facilities can create a seamless and secure patient intake experience.
